The BJP is gearing up to organise a series of caste-based rallies across the state as part of its preparation for the coming elections even as the party's Parivarthana Yatra enters its last leg.

The B S Yeddyurappa-led Navakarnataka Nirmana Parivarthana Yatra is scheduled to conclude on January 25 in Mysuru. To begin with, the party will organise a rally in Bengaluru, in which Prime Minister Narendra Modi will participate, on February 4. An estimated five lakh people are expected to take part in what is planned as a show-of-strength to be held at the sprawling Palace Grounds.

This will be followed by rallies across the state. Separate rallies will be organised targetting various castes, scheduled castes, scheduled tribes and other backward classes. Besides, there will be separate rallies for women, youth and farmers. National leaders of the party and chief ministers of BJP-ruled states will be addressing these rallies, the party sources said.

This apart, the party has planned to hold issue-based yatras at the local level. For instance, party MLAs in Bengaluru have been asked to organise a yatra on issues related to the crumbling infrastructure in the city, the sources said.
